Recipe Details
Ingredients
-
¼cupbutter
-
4apples, peeled and diced into 1/4-inch cubes
-
½cupbrown sugar
-
¼cupwhite sugar
-
1 ½teaspoonslemon juice
-
1 ½teaspoonsground cinnamon
-
½teaspoonvanilla extract
-
¼teaspoonsalt
-
¼teaspoonground nutmeg
-
¼teaspoonground allspice
-
⅛teaspoonground cloves
-
2tablespoonswater
-
1tablespooncornstarch
-
4sheetspie crust pastries
-
1teaspoonall-purpose flour
-
¾cupconfectioners’ sugar
-
1teaspoonground cinnamon
-
1teaspoonvanilla extract
-
1 ½tablespoonsmilk
Cooking Directions
-
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
-
Melt butter in a saucepan over medium heat. Add apples; toss until coated with butter. Stir in brown sugar, white sugar, lemon juice, 1 1/2 teaspoons cinnamon, 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ract, salt, nutmeg, allspice, and cloves; cook and stir until apples have softened and sugars have melted, about 5 minutes. Bring to a boil.
-
Combine water and cornstarch in a bowl. Stir cornstarch mixture into the apple mixture; cook and stir until apple mixture is thickened, about 5 minutes. Remove from heat; cool completely, about 20 minutes.
-
Roll out 1 sheet of pie crust on a work surface with a rolling pin; cover with half of the cooled apple mixture. Roll out a second sheet of pie crust with a rolling pin; slice into 1/2-inch wide strips with a sharp knife. Weave pie crust strips together over the apple mixture to create a lattice top.
-
Flour a round cookie cutter or drinking glass. Press cookie cutter through the dough to create 12 round pies. Transfer to a baking sheet.
-
Bake in the preheated oven until crust is cooked through and golden brown, about 20 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ack to cool, about 10 minutes.
-
Repeat with remaining pie crusts and apple mixture; place on a second baking sheet. Bake in the oven until crust is cooked through and golden brown, about 20 minutes.
-
Combine confectioners’ sugar and 1 teaspoon cinnamon in a mixing bowl; add 1 teaspoon vanilla extract. Stir in milk slowly until desired consistency is reached; drizzle over cooled pies.
Cook’s Note:
The “scraps” from cutting out the cookies can also be baked and drizzled with icing.
